Anelasticity in austenitic stainless steel
Acta Materialia, 2012Time-dependent anelastic deformation mechanisms arise in austenitic stainless steel when load is removed during a high-temperature creep test. This phenomenon is investigated by conducting creep tests, with intermittent load removal, on AISI Type 316H austenitic stainless steel at 550 and 650 °C, supported by in situ measurement of creep-induced ...
